    Abstract: An adjustment tool assembly for a firearm comprised of a double-sided adjuster tool and a housing having a handle. Each end of the double-sided adjuster tool can be comprised of a tool, each tool can have a shaft, and a middle portion can be positioned between the shaft of each tool end. The handle of the housing can have a receiving cavity for at least a portion of the double-sided adjuster tool, and the middle portion of the adjuster tool can engage with the receiving cavity to secure the adjuster tool to the handle.

    Abstract: A bore guide comprised of a rear housing, an adjustable shaft having a proximal and a distal end, a tip on the distal end of the adjustable shaft, a spring housing connected to the proximal end of the adjustable shaft, a spring located inside the spring housing, and a lock insertable into a portion of a firearm to lock the spring in a compressed state. The rear housing may have a rear opening on a proximal end of the rear housing and a solvent port on a circumferential portion of the rear housing. Transition of the adjustable shaft toward the rear opening can cause compression of the spring. The lock can secure the bore guide in place and create a seal within the bore of the firearm.

    Abstract: An adjustable support stand can include a front support on a first end of the adjustable support stand having a grip comprised of a first, front support material; and a rear support on an opposing, second end of the adjustable support stand having a grip comprised of a first, rear support material, wherein the front and the rear supports can each have at least two vertical arms, at least one of the supports can have vertically stacked chevron voids on each arm, and the chevron voids can be deformable by the object being worked upon to secure and grip the object in place.

    Abstract: Exemplary embodiments of the present invention relate methods and devices for measuring flow rate of particulate matter within an exhaust gas stream. In one particular exemplary embodiment, a sensor for detecting and monitoring particulate matter within an exhaust flow path of an engine is provided. The sensor includes a housing having an attachment for mounting the sensor. The sensor also includes a sensing rod supported by an insulating base. The sensing rod is attached to the housing and includes a probe adapted to be placed within the exhaust flow path. The probe includes a section having an increased surface area per unit length as compared to at least one other section of the probe. The sensing rod is configured to detect particulate matter flowing through the exhaust component and generates a signal based thereupon. The sensor further includes an electrical connector in communication with the sensing rod.

    Abstract: Disclosed is a process and apparatus for conducting bio-oxidation processes for the extraction of metals from metal containing materials in which aeration means, preferably a diffuser means, is employed within a bio-oxidation reactor to maintain bacterial viability and suspension of metal containing materials by introduction of an oxygen containing gas to a non-mechanically agitated reactor.
